Transaction abf2173d18e37efafe1dbc55853ff275d66eccc6f290f4b6bd7f650e4b75e96d
1 Input
2 Outputs
- abf2173d18e37efafe1dbc55853ff275d66eccc6f290f4b6bd7f650e4b75e96d:0
- abf2173d18e37efafe1dbc55853ff275d66eccc6f290f4b6bd7f650e4b75e96d:1
value 25126257
address 3MbzuvTDdhgH3oWEakdxJvcCbW1bwBS6rJ
value 117763966
address 3HacAcC8J6GWF9g5JMbmLdJmrjTr6pcWC7